Why my ac work in 2005 peterbilt truck?

Potential causes for an AC not working in a 2005 Peterbilt truck:

Here are some potential causes of why your AC may not be working in your 2005 Peterbilt truck:

Low refrigerant level: If the refrigerant level is too low, the AC system may not be able to generate cold air.

Faulty compressor: The compressor is responsible for compressing the refrigerant and circulating it through the system. If the compressor fails, the AC will not work.

Malfunctioning condenser: The condenser is responsible for releasing heat from the refrigerant. If the condenser is damaged or clogged, the AC will not be able to cool the air properly.

Broken expansion valve: The expansion valve controls the flow of refrigerant into the evaporator. If the expansion valve is faulty, the AC will not be able to cool the air properly.

Electrical issues: Electrical problems, such as a faulty AC relay or wiring issues, can also prevent the AC from working.
